Ellis Paul to perform at 6OTS

OXFORD – Local music venue 6 On the Square will come alive Saturday, Nov. 24 starting at 7:30 p.m. with the unique voice, guitar and piano of nationally acclaimed folk artist Ellis Paul.
"Ellis has a voice that is so powerful that you know who it is the second he comes through your radio. His music and songs are a new birth in American sound that makes me want to go see concerts again," said Kristian Bush of the pop-country band Sugarland in a statement.
Ellis Paul is a fiercely independent and critically acclaimed musician who has traveled tirelessly to promote his music and his vision of what it means to be a true “Working Musician.”
The recipient of 14 Boston Music Awards, Paul blurs the lines between pop and folk on a regular basis and has entertained crowds across America with his vivid imagery and adept musicianship. Paul has honed his craft by performing more than 150 shows annually for the past 20 years and continues to take to stages large and small from the likes of The Rock N Roll Hall of Fame to Carnegie Hall and small clubs, festivals and coffeehouses.
Paul is currently on tour to promote his next studio album, which is nearing completion and expected to be released in early 2014. The album, which is being produced by Kristian Bush of the Nashville duo Sugarland, is an example of the new business model of performing musicians.
The project is being completely funded by fans of Paul, and to date the nearly 600 donors to the cause have raised more than $100,000.
This album will mark Paul's 17th studio album through the Black Wolf record label, which he co-founded in 1994 while emerging from the Boston music scene.
Before the feature album’s arrival, Paul will be releasing a holiday album dubbed “City of Silver Dreams,” which features nine original holiday tracks; some of which were co-written by Jennifer Nettles and Kristian Bush of the Grammy Award-winning duo Sugarland. The holiday album was given to donors ahead of it's commercial release as an incentive to support the new album, still in the production phases.
